Help - Search - Members - Calendar
Full Version: Realtek ALC 889A onboard sound
InsanelyMac Forum > OSx86 Project > Hardware and Drivers > Sound
aqua-mac
This is a recent update to ALC 888. Does anyone know how to get this going? I have tried Skippy Retards ALC 888 but it is a no go. Any help appreciated.

Thanks,

aquamac
siddharth
Get a linux codec dump & try Taruga's AppleHDA solution.
aqua-mac
Thanks for the response Siddharth, Any ideas where I can get a linux dump for the 889 ?. I have looked around, but cannot seem to find one.
showthan
I have the same question
ninetto
QUOTE (showthan @ Aug 5 2007, 11:00 PM) *
I have the same question


Use a linux-live cd that you can download at any linux-distro site for free. I recommend SABAYON that someone recommended to me at the Targu thread.
Boot from the CD.
With SABAYON it is as simple as finding the codec0 under /proc/asound/card0 or similiar.
Then drag 'n drop that file to a usb stick or other location.
Install using Targu's Patcher (ver. 1.16 is for the new kernel!)

with linux terminal the commands look like this:
n the linux terminal type "/proc/asound" then find the file "codec#0" (note: the file does not necessarily be directly inside 'asound' but could be in a folder or in a folder . . . inside asound) , once you have located the file type in the terminal "cat codec#0 > /tmp/nameofcodec.txt" . for me i did this inside a livecd so i "dumped" it into my usb flash drive instead of the "/tmp" directory. (reminder: execute the commands without the quotes

ok
good luck,
ninetto
3phemeral
edit: New link for full ALC889A [in/out/digital] support. This is a newer link than the one below. Credits to kossi.

original post
QUOTE (aqua-mac @ May 27 2007, 07:30 AM) *
This is a recent update to ALC 888. Does anyone know how to get this going? I have tried Skippy Retards ALC 888 but it is a no go. Any help appreciated.
Hey,
I know it's been awhile since you asked, but still. Note that I haven't tried this yet since i haven't received my GA-P35-DS4 [been waiting for over 2 weeks now :/].
QUOTE (peterg @ Aug 11 2007, 07:48 AM) *
hey
to get audio working on my P35-DQ6 motherboard
- make sure BIOS has AZALIA enabled.
- i found an azalia kext on this forum.
- i modified the kext to work with the device id of the alc889 chip.
i do not have microphone input working. and i don't know if the surround sound works, but hey, it can beep!

I have included a copy of the file if that helps.
uncompress this kext and store in S/L/E and change the permissions, ownership and reload the kexts

P.
Link to file: AppleAzaliaAudio.kext.zip.
[Second] Link to topic: http://forum.insanelymac.com/index.php?showtopic=57762
Of course all credit goes out to peterg smile.gif
PARUSA
can the supplied kext be use on leopard? i installed (IATKOS release) leopard on my GA-X38-DQ6 mobo but there's no audio, i have the same chipset for sound which is REALTEK ALC889A...

can this work?

TIA.
aqua-mac
Yes you should be fine. Download the New Link and remove the azalia kext if you have it. You will need to repair permissions in the terminal.

Download
PARUSA
QUOTE (aqua-mac @ Dec 24 2007, 04:18 PM) *
Yes you should be fine. Download the New Link and remove the azalia kext if you have it. You will need to repair permissions in the terminal.


hi again, could you please provide the steps you made and the files to download. i might download the wrong one.
socal swimmer
Hey I recently wrote a full install guide for the GA P35-DS3P (leopard), which has that exact sound card. here is the relevant section from my guide:

*********************** begin sound fix: ***********************


find alc889a here: http://rapidshare.com/files/51585161/alc889a.zip.html

-(on this thread: http://forum.insanelymac.com/index.php?sho...;p=436207&#)

copy alc889a (which is a folder with 2 folders in it) onto a thumbdrive

boot into install dvd (many do this next section from single user, but I have always used the dvd)

open terminal

cd /Volumes/thumbdrive/alc889a


mv ALCinject.kext /Volumes/DrivewithLeopard/System/Library/Extensions/ALCinject.kext <press enter>

mv AppleHDA.kext /Volumes/DrivewithLeopard/System/Library/Extensions/AppleHDA.kext <press enter>

chmod -R 755 /Volumes/DrivewithLeopard/System/Library/Extensions/ALCinject.kext <press enter>

chmod -R 755 /Volumes/DrivewithLeopard/System/Library/Extensions/AppleHDA.kext <press enter>

chown -R root:wheel /Volumes/DrivewithLeopard/System/Library/Extensions/ALCinject.kext <press enter>

chown -R root:wheel /Volumes/DrivewithLeopard/System/Library/Extensions/AppleHDA.kext <press enter>

rm -R /Volumes/DrivewithLeopard/System/Library/Extensions.kextcache <press enter>

(it says "no such file or directory". ignore that, its ok)

rm -R /Volumes/DrivewithLeopard/System/Library/Extensions.mkext <press enter>

reboot <press enter>

enjoy fully working audio... verify in the Audio Panel that you have fully working audio...

*********************** end sound fix ***********************


it gives working 2 channel out on front panel (connected to the HDA jack on the mobo during assembly) and back panel, with front and back input recognized but not tested.
Wizper
Easy solution for Alc889a:
- download AppleHDAPatcherv1.20.zip http://forum.insanelymac.com/index.php?sho...p;hl=HDApatcher
- download ALC889Adump.txt
- unpack AppleHDAPatcherv1.20.zip
- drag and drop ALC889Adump.txt to AppleHDAPatcherv1.20 icon
- restart
- enjoy! biggrin.gif

PS work with Kalyway 10.5.1
kwpang1
but it says

Codec: Realtek ALC885
Address: 2
Vendor Id: 0x10ec0885
Subsystem Id: 0x1458a002
Revision Id: 0x100101
Default PCM:
rates [0x560]: 44100 48000 96000 192000
bits [0xe]: 16 20 24
formats [0x1]: PCM
Default Amp-In caps: N/A
Default Amp-Out caps: N/A

...

can it still be used for ALC889?

any by the way.
  1. Does AppleHDA / AppleAzalia / ALCinject come default with leopard?
  2. To fix ALC889, which do i need to replace: AppleHDA / AppleAzalia / ALCinject?
  3. Which can i delete?
I'm on GA-P35-DS3R
Thanks
socal swimmer
if you use the link I provided, then you simply have to add those two kexts to the extensions folder. You should replace any kexts already there.
kwpang1
my speakers are plugged in but it says inbuilt speakers in output panel
same for inbuild microphone.

any help?
socal swimmer
well if everything is working correctly it should look something like this.

oh, one more thing: When you built the computer, did you plug the front panel audio in to the HDA pins, or the AC97 pins? I used HDA.

for me, line out is the black jack on the back, and headphones are the front panel audio
foureight84
works very well. but is there any way to enable 4.1? i'm using klipsch 4.1 so the rear and sub is the same jack. i can't get the rear to work.
Fesob
QUOTE (socal swimmer @ Dec 30 2007, 09:14 AM) *
well if everything is working correctly it should look something like this.


I'm looking for a motherboard for my new HTPC.
The main issue is audio.
So far i've only found Taruga's ALC882 100% working; most of the people can get Line out and Mic to work with other ALC devices but i can't get correct info about digital output and i'd really like to have it.

Could you please tell me if you can get Mic and digital (Coaxial or Optical, it doesn't matter) output from ALC889a with 10.5.1?

Thank you so much!
Joe Micro
QUOTE (Wizper @ Dec 26 2007, 09:45 PM) *
Easy solution for Alc889a:
- download AppleHDAPatcherv1.20.zip http://forum.insanelymac.com/index.php?sho...p;hl=HDApatcher
- download ALC889Adump.txt
- unpack AppleHDAPatcherv1.20.zip
- drag and drop ALC889Adump.txt to AppleHDAPatcherv1.20 icon
- restart
- enjoy! :D

PS work with Kalyway 10.5.1


I have use this method to fix the Gigabyte P35-DS3 Audio ,but got this message
"Detected unsupported Realtek Codec".Anything wrong ? Thanks everyone's great work!

PS.Installed with Kalyway 10.5.1
clv101
My audio works with the Realtek ALC889A, 2 channel output at least, haven't tried anything else. See how I did it in the link in my sig.
Joe Micro
QUOTE (clv101 @ Jan 31 2008, 05:17 PM) *
My audio works with the Realtek ALC889A, 2 channel output at least, haven't tried anything else. See how I did it in the link in my sig.

Yes,It really works. tongue.gif
Many thanks.
MowgliBook
Everything works like a charm, except analog 5.1 using EFI and GFX Strings, and there is an issue with shtudown on P35-DS4 (it gonna be solve soon)
helob
QUOTE (Joe Micro @ Jan 31 2008, 04:51 PM) *
I have use this method to fix the Gigabyte P35-DS3 Audio ,but got this message
"Detected unsupported Realtek Codec".Anything wrong ? Thanks everyone's great work!

PS.Installed with Kalyway 10.5.1


Hi,
I have the same Mobo P35-DS3 as yours and with Kalyway 10.5.1 installed too.
I encountered the same error msg after dragging ALC889a.txt to AppleHDA Patcher V1.20
*Detected unsupported Codec
Codec:,VendorId,SystemID all shown blank in AppleHDA Patcher.
Did you manage to solve the problem?
Inspite of the error msg, stereo audio is working.
Would appreciate your help and advise.
Thanks
iautsi
Mine works great too, except front panel audio input never detected.Might somebody tells me how to add a external audio input option onto the system preference .

my system configuration: GA-P35-DS3,E4400 M0,7600GT,WD 250G SATAII,IDE DVD RW,USB KB,USB Mouse
install from Kalyway 10.5.1 and updated 10.5.2
doctor_fruitbat
I tried following Socal Swimmer's advice, but whenever I try to do anything in the terminal it turns out I don't have permission. I've tried setting permissions to the Extensions folder to Read & Write, but that did nothing. Help please? tongue.gif
socal swimmer
QUOTE (doctor_fruitbat @ Mar 3 2008, 03:55 PM) *
I tried following Socal Swimmer's advice, but whenever I try to do anything in the terminal it turns out I don't have permission. I've tried setting permissions to the Extensions folder to Read & Write, but that did nothing. Help please? tongue.gif


you must type:

sudo -s <press enter> <type in your admin password> <press enter>


then all the commands.

biggrin.gif

good luck!
LS8
Does line-in/mic-in work for anyone with alc889a on Leopard?
CJMclean
QUOTE (Wizper @ Dec 26 2007, 09:45 PM) *
Easy solution for Alc889a:
- download AppleHDAPatcherv1.20.zip http://forum.insanelymac.com/index.php?sho...p;hl=HDApatcher
- download ALC889Adump.txt
- unpack AppleHDAPatcherv1.20.zip
- drag and drop ALC889Adump.txt to AppleHDAPatcherv1.20 icon
- restart
- enjoy! biggrin.gif

PS work with Kalyway 10.5.1


Just wanted to say this works!
Thank you!
Alpor
QUOTE (Wizper @ Dec 26 2007, 01:45 PM) *
Easy solution for Alc889a:
- download AppleHDAPatcherv1.20.zip http://forum.insanelymac.com/index.php?sho...p;hl=HDApatcher
- download ALC889Adump.txt
- unpack AppleHDAPatcherv1.20.zip
- drag and drop ALC889Adump.txt to AppleHDAPatcherv1.20 icon
- restart
- enjoy! biggrin.gif

PS work with Kalyway 10.5.1


It works for me!!!
I'm using Gigabyte P35-DS3P rev.1.1 with 10.5.2 (installed from Leo4All dvd).
(But note - you should drag & drop dump file to UNLAUNCHED patcher,
i.e. _do_not_ launch it before. It is very strange behavior, but it does not matter - it works.)
saivert
QUOTE (Wizper @ Dec 26 2007, 02:45 PM) *
Easy solution for Alc889a:
...


Thank you very much!

Here is my proof:


(click image for full size)

My hardware:

Motherboard: Gigabyte GA-P35-DS4 rev. 1.0 (which has the ALC889A chip)
CPU: Intel Core 2 Duo E6750 overclocked to 3GHz
RAM: 2x Corsair TWIN2X CL4 PC2-6400 and 2x Corsair TWIN2X CL5 PC2-8000 for a total of 4GB
Graphics: NVIDIA GeForce 8800GTS 320MB (ASUS)
LS8
How about the line-in / mic-in? Does it work for you?
daclothe
For the life of me I cannot get SPDIF output with this audio chipset. My board is a Gigybyte eP35-DS3R and it's giving me nothing but problems when trying to send optical out. I haven't tried digital coax, but headphones do work, so it's not all for naught.

I have tried socal's method, taruga's with a linux codec dump, and even CMI8738PCIAudioDriver and none of them want to give me optical.

Help? Thoughts? Suggestions?
TIA
kev_in
I can say using the codec dump + AppleHDA Patcher 1.20
The microphone is half working...
because i cannot make a smooth speech using msn messenger (VMware with XP)
it like a lag in every mili-sec or something...

Everyone should try to see if they have this problem.!!

Also, anyone can tell which part of the codec dump is the mic?
So I might try and mod it myself to get a better quality of the input mic sound
002055
Well it doesn't work for me.

I've tried both methods outlined in this thread, both methods show additional options available in the sound control panel such as line out, digital out etc which is an improvement over not having anything show up however neither method actually produces any sound!

So, my motherboard is a Gigabyte P35 DS3R v1.1 with the ALC889A onboard sound.

Does anyone have any idea what I'm doing wrong?

Cheers

Ben
AZBESZT
neither working for me. at least... when i set the output in system preferences/sound to built-in speaker, then only the two front speakers give sound, and when the output is built-in line output, then only the rear speakers give sound. system profiler says no built-in audio.

and there's no mic input at all.

i have GA X48T-DQ6 motherboard


any ideas?
thx
koodoo
Thanks!
Hurrycane-j
Hey Folks.

I have some problems installing the driver.
My Gigabyte EP45-DS3 has an ALC889a chip but if i do it, like Wizper said, the HDAPatcher (1.20) says:
QUOTE
AppleHDA Patcher - 2006/2007 by Taruga v1.20

_______________________________________________________
Codec : Realtek ALC885
Vendor Id : 0x10ec0885
Subsystem Id : 0x1458a002
_______________________________________________________


* Detected unsupported Realtek Codec


Does he think, that i have an ALC885 Chip? i already tried an ALC885 dump file, but that doesn't work too
Hurrycane-j
I found a solution without patching ;-)
http://forum.insanelymac.com/index.php?act...st&id=27629
here you can download the ALC889.pkg and you won't have problems with the sound anymore :-P
JayIn805
QUOTE
I found a solution without patching ;-)
http://forum.insanelymac.com/index.php?act...st&id=27629
here you can download the ALC889.pkg and you won't have problems with the sound anymore :-P


Were you using this on the ALC889A chipset? I just ran it and it wiped away the sound setup I had before.

As a side note, is anyone getting sound that kind of sounds staticy? When a sound first plays using the ALC889A kext I used before, it sounds like there is a little pop before starting.
JayIn805
I followed the instructions with ALC889adump.txt and that fixed it.

Sound is the best it's been yet. Still has a little pop when sound first starts.
LS8
QUOTE (Hurrycane-j @ Jan 23 2009, 11:17 PM) *
I found a solution without patching ;-)
http://forum.insanelymac.com/index.php?act...st&id=27629
here you can download the ALC889.pkg and you won't have problems with the sound anymore :-P


Can you provide some further information about this package, please? Where did you find it?
Hurrycane-j
i found a link to that file in a spanish text document, which i didn't understand.
but i downloaded the file and installed it and after that my sound worked and everything was good :-P

i think you may get some more informations if you search for "ALC889.pkg"
LS8
Thank you. I found further info, it is an old driver which requires ALC injector.

The lastest driver 1.6.2a37_3outs3ins_digital_HDA_headphone.zip from http://forum.insanelymac.com/index.php?sho...140941&st=0 works much better for me, including front panel, mic in and automatic muting.
cacti
ive tried every way in this thread an cant get my alc889a to work sad.gif
mrpena
QUOTE (Wizper @ Dec 26 2007, 07:45 AM) *
Easy solution for Alc889a:
- download AppleHDAPatcherv1.20.zip http://forum.insanelymac.com/index.php?sho...p;hl=HDApatcher
- download ALC889Adump.txt
- unpack AppleHDAPatcherv1.20.zip
- drag and drop ALC889Adump.txt to AppleHDAPatcherv1.20 icon
- restart
- enjoy! biggrin.gif

PS work with Kalyway 10.5.1


this didn't work for Gigabyte GA-58EX-UD3R..
Dith
QUOTE (mrpena @ May 25 2009, 07:00 PM) *
this didn't work for Gigabyte GA-58EX-UD3R..


The UD3R has an ALC888 soundcard. I've tried tons of kexts with 10.5.7 but wasn't able to get it working. I didn't look into using the patcher + dump to get it working though.

The way I solved it was by replacing AppleHDA.kext in /S/L/E with the AppleHDA.kext from 10.5.6. Use any ALC888 you'd like and it should work on 10.5.7. If you're still running =<10.5.6 you don't have to replace AppleHDA.kext.

I should note that I was using Wolfie's EFI boot partition with Kexts but switched to using Chameleon and the /Extra dir for kexts. I tried changing the version number of AppleHDA.kext (10.5.6) and all the other kexts located inside to try and keep /S/L/E vanilla, however this does not work. Just so you know smile.gif

I'm not at home so I can't provide you with a direct link to the kexts I used but if you use the search: EX58-UD3R or ALC888 you will definitely find drivers.
alex-nord-star
has anybody managed to get 5.1 sound ? i've tried with some patches and fixes but nothing worked sad.gif ... i only have 2 channel sound...

i have ALC889A.
Snowski
I'm also looking for a solution. 32/64bit and 5.1 support for ALC889a but I can't seem to get a straight answer anywhere.
This is a "lo-fi" version of our main content. To view the full version with more information, formatting and images, please click here.